V = value of goods (stated as being same for each woman)
Clara's wage = 40(20) + 0.05V
Rose's wage = 40(16) + 0.10V
<pr>
Since their wages are stated as being equal:
40(20) + 0.05V = 40(16) + 0.10V
<pr>
800 + 0.05V = 640 + 0.10V
<pr>
160 = 0.05V
<pr>
V = 3200
<pr>
Clara's wage = 40(20) + 0.05V = 800 + 160 = 960
Rose's wage = 40(16) + 0.10V = 640 + 320 = 960
<pr>
They each sold $3200 worth of goods and each earned $960.
